James C. Murray, Jr.
James C. Murray, Jr. was a judge of the 11th Cook County Subcircuit. He was appointed to this position on May 31, 2001. After retiring, he was recalled to the Cook County Circuit Court for a term that began on July 1, 2008 and ended on Dec. 4, 2011.[1][2][3]
2012 election
Murray was running for election to the Cook County 12th Subcircuit in 2012, but withdrew from the race on March 2, 2012.[4]
